Memories of Old Cahaba.

Nashville, TN: Publishing House of the M.E. Church, South, Printed for the author, 1908. First edition. 12mo.128 pp. Illustrated from photographs and line drawings, plates. Includes a 70-page history of the community, a 30-page memoir in verse, a sketch of the Cahaba Rifles of the 5th Alabama Infantry with a very detailed roster, written by Capt. Charles Pegues, describing war incidents for each member of the company, and a 4-page "church history." Laid in is an autograph letter from the author (8vo, 4 pp.; 8 March 1929 from Montgomery) to Alabama book collector and historian Peter Brannan, inviting him to a meeting of the Cahaba Memorial Association and giving news of friends. Dornbusch II, 31. Though widely held in research libraries, this work seems to be missing from those in North and South Carolina, Georgia, and Florida. Very good.
